Apartment for sale in Sunny Beach

The offered apartment is located in a holiday residential complex in the famous Sunny Beach resort. The complex offers many amenities such as swimming pool, security and maintenance.
 
The complex is situated about 300 m from the beach. It is in a peaceful and quiet area but close to all attractions the resort could offer.
 
The apartment is sold completely furnished and equipped - with air conditioning, fridge, TV, stove for cooking. The finishing is turnkey – floor covers, interior doors, faience in the sanitary premises, sanitary equipment, hydro and thermal isolation. The apartment is on the second floor of the six storey building. There is a possibility for rent out.
 
The total living area is 77 sq m and the apartment consists of two bedrooms, living room with kitchen, large terrace overlooking the pool and a bathroom with WC.
